Performance Evidence

Evidence required to demonstrate competence must satisfy all of the requirements of the elements and performance criteria. If not otherwise specified the candidate must demonstrate evidence of performance of the following on at least one occasion.

applying legislation, regulations and policies relating to implementation and monitoring of return to work plans

reading and applying complex information

using communication with a diverse range of people including the injured worker, supervisor, work colleagues, medical adviser

negotiating direction of rehabilitation and actions required

managing competing imperatives, motives, agendas and needs


Knowledge Evidence

Evidence required to demonstrate competence must satisfy all of the requirements of the elements and performance criteria. If not otherwise specified the depth of knowledge demonstrated must be appropriate to the job context of the candidate.

public sector legislation, including work health and safety, and environment

regulations, policies, procedures, guidelines and best practice principles relating to injury management

privacy legislation

legislation and standards to ensure confidentiality and security of information

performance standards

legislated requirements of the return to work plan

requirements of organisation’s return to work policy and program

redeployment principles
